Skip to content

Commit 7d52ec4

Browse files
authored
Fixes (#102)
* Clean older sdk files * Regenerate doc * Fix bugs
1 parent c72694a commit 7d52ec4

File tree

32 files changed

+8226
-7352
lines changed

32 files changed

+8226
-7352
lines changed

eslint.config.mjs

Lines changed: 15 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-1,19 +1,25 @@
1-
import { defaultConfig } from '@caido/eslint-config';
2-
import markdownPlugin from '@eslint/markdown';
1+
import { defaultConfig } from "@caido/eslint-config";
2+
import markdownPlugin from "@eslint/markdown";
33

44
/** @type {import('eslint').Linter.Config } */
55
export default [
66
{
7-
ignores: [".vitepress/cache", ".vitepress/dist", "./src/reference/sdks", "./src/reference/modules"],
7+
ignores: [
8+
".vitepress/cache",
9+
".vitepress/dist",
10+
"./src/reference/sdks",
11+
"./src/reference/modules",
12+
"src/reference/api.md",
13+
],
814
},
9-
...(markdownPlugin.configs.recommended.map(config => ({
15+
...markdownPlugin.configs.recommended.map((config) => ({
1016
...config,
1117
languageOptions: {
12-
frontmatter: "yaml"
13-
}
14-
}))),
15-
...(defaultConfig().map(config => ({
18+
frontmatter: "yaml",
19+
},
20+
})),
21+
...defaultConfig().map((config) => ({
1622
...config,
1723
files: ["**/*.ts", "**/*.vue"],
18-
}))),
24+
})),
1925
];

scripts/sdk.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,11 @@ cd ../sdk-js
66
pnpm generate:doc
77

88
echo "[*] Copying doc"
9+
rm -rf ../doc-developer/src/reference/sdks/backend/*
910
cp -r ./packages/sdk-backend/docs/* ../doc-developer/src/reference/sdks/backend/
11+
rm -rf ../doc-developer/src/reference/sdks/frontend/*
1012
cp -r ./packages/sdk-frontend/docs/* ../doc-developer/src/reference/sdks/frontend/
13+
rm -rf ../doc-developer/src/reference/sdks/workflow/*
1114
cp -r ./packages/sdk-workflow/docs/* ../doc-developer/src/reference/sdks/workflow/
15+
rm -rf ../doc-developer/src/reference/modules/*
1216
cp -r ./packages/quickjs-types/docs/* ../doc-developer/src/reference/modules/

0 commit comments

Comments
 (0)